WebSep 6, 2024 · Yes, in certain instances nursing home expenses are deductible medical expenses. If you, your spouse, or your dependent is in a nursing home primarily for medical care, then the entire nursing home cost (including meals and lodging) is deductible as a medical expense. If a senior needs minimal assistance, home care could be sufficient, but if someone needs comprehensive care, a nursing home might be the best choice. When the senior is mobile but needs some help with day-to-day activities, an assisted living residence may be suitable.
